Clarification, Alexa page rank depends not only on the number of visitors, but also on the number of web pages on unique sites that point to your blog.
For example, many people visit your blog everyday... BUT! only a few (say only two) sites link back to you -- your Alexa rating wouldn't nudge definitely.
For people to visit your site and link to your pages, they must enjoy your content... and for them to enjoy your content, it must be visible on search engines... and it isn't a matter of a silver bullet to accomplish that. It takes time (years, in fact!), patience, and hard work. Newbie bloggers whose sites don't offer much content of interest never succeed in this area. Believe me, I know.

Link backs can be indentified if you have installed Google Webmaster Tools support on your blog. You will have to signup first here:
www.google.com/webmasters/tools
Then install the verification on your blog, then check for external links.
